Hi,

Twice now, I've tried to install a game I've used on at least five different
computers (with XP) onto my new Dell XPS 410 with Vista Home Premium only to
reach a point where there is an error in the install and suddenly my Taskbar,
Start Menu, Desktop Icons are all Missing and I cannot right-click anywhere
on the desktop. This is a brand new machine on which I'd done updates, and
then the install. The first time this happened, tried system restore, then
finally re-installed Vista entirely. After reinstalling, I uninstalled a few
things (like AOL & Earthlink related apps), updated, then tried the game
install again with the exact same results.

This is so frustrating that I'm considering just installing XP on this brand
new machine.

Ugh. Sorry about that last post.

Anyway, the only solutions/suggestions I found with AO is to try to install
it in another directory with Administrative Privilages. This has seemed to
work for people up to patch 17.2, where it seems to work/not work depending
on the user. Give that a shot and see what develops.
